Austrian international goalkeeper signs new long-term deal with Arsenal

Arsenal goalkeeper Manuela Zinsberger has put pen to paper to sign a new deal which will keep her at Meadow Park for the long term according to reports on The Gunners’ official website.

The 25-year-old Austrian international stopper joined The Gunners from Bayern Munich in 2019 and the player has gone on to be a regular starter for Arsenal head coach Joe Montemurro.

It has today been announced that Arsenal have come to an agreement with Zinsberger which will keep her at the club for the long term. Full details of the contract signed by the player have not been disclosed, however, it is thought that Zinsberger will remain in North London until at least summer 2023.

Zinsberger made 12 appearances in the Barclays FA Women’s Super League for The Gunners last season, keeping a clean sheet every other game. This term she has added eight further league outings to her tally but has kept just one shut-out which came in Arsenal’s 5-0 win at Brighton & Hove Albion in October. The keeper will be hoping to put in a match-winning performance for her side when they welcome latest opponents Manchester City to Meadow Park on Sunday.

Later this month, Zinsberger will jet off to Malta to link up with the Austrian squad for the Visit Malta Women’s Trophy tournament. She is the most-capped goalkeeper in the Austrian squad having represented her nation on 66 occasions at senior level.
